Derks Vroomans Project » Gerardus Derks (1888-????)

Personal data Gerardus Derks 

  • He was born on March 7, 1888 in Wijchen, NL.

  • Profession: Fabrieksarbeider / boswachter.
  • A child of Martinus Derks and Petronella Kuppen

Household of Gerardus Derks

He is married to Antonia Nikkelen.

They got married on November 8, 1918 at Nijmegen, NL, he was 30 years old.
